Rice Stadium (Rice University)
Rice Stadium is an American football stadium located on the Rice University campus in Houston, Texas. It has been the home of the Rice Owls football team since its... Wikipedia
- Former names: Houston Stadium
- Location: 6100 South Main Street, Houston, Texas, U.S.
- Owner: Rice University
- Operator: Rice University
- Capacity: 47,000, (expandable to 59,000), Super Bowl VIII (68,142)
- Surface: Natural grass (1950–1969), AstroTurf (1970–2005), FieldTurf (2006–2014), AstroTurf GameDay Grass 3D60H (2014–present)
- Broke ground: February 1950
- Opened: September 30, 1950
- Construction cost: $3.295 million, ($ in 2015 dollars)
- Architect: Hermon Lloyd & W.B. Morgan and Milton McGinty
- General contractor: Brown & Root Constructors
